Yash’s next with director Anil Kumar is a sequel to Kirathaka

After five years, the actor is set to play a rustic village youth once again in the sequel to his 2011 hit

A Sharadhaa

When Yash donned the role of a rustic village lad in Kirathaka and Raja Huli, he caught the eyes of audiences across the state. The two films, set against the Mandya backdrop, were not only runaway hits at the box office, they also put the actor in the spotlight.

With fans hoping to see the star in similar roles, Yash seems to have given in to their wishes. After five years, he will once again play such a role on the silver screen. The film that the actor has signed is helmed by Anil Kumar. According to our sources, the project that is bringing together this actor-director will be a sequel to Kirathaka. However, an official title is yet to be finalised. “This will be the next film that Yash will begin to shoot after KGF,” says a source.

Even as the actor has back-to-back projects lined up, this yet-to-be titled  film will go on floors soon. “Apart from Anil’s project, Yash will be associating with director Harsha and Narthan. While the former is currently busy with another film, the latter is getting ready with the script. So, Yash, not wasting time has decided to start with Anil’s project. He will then follow it up with those two,” adds our source.
